Scientists have recently identified and succeeded in synthesizing conolidine, a normal compound that displays guarantee for a powerful analgesic agent with a more favorable safety profile. Although the actual system of action remains elusive, it is actually now postulated that conolidine may have a lot of biologic targets. Presently, conolidine has long been revealed to inhibit Cav2.two calcium channels and increase the availability of endogenous opioid peptides by binding to a not too long ago recognized opioid scavenger ACKR3. Although the identification of conolidine as a possible novel analgesic agent gives an additional avenue to handle the opioid crisis and control CNCP, even further reports are needed to grasp its system of action and utility and efficacy in handling CNCP.
